The automotive sector currently employs over 5.45 million people in Japan and is worth some 47.3 trillion yen. It is little surprise then that Japan is the third largest manufacturer of vehicles, producing 9,278,321 in 2015. Japan's major export industries include automobiles, consumer electronics (see Electronics industry in Japan), computers, semiconductors, copper, iron and steel.. Additional key industries in Japan's economy are petrochemicals, pharmaceuticals, bioindustry, shipbuilding, aerospace, textiles, and processed foods.. Japanese manufacturing industry is heavily dependent on imported raw materials . Japan's main imports are machinery and equipment, fossil fuels, foodstuffs, chemicals, and raw materials for its industries. Japan was the fourth largest market for U.S. agricultural exports, valued at $11.9 billion in 2017. The United States is the largest supplier of food and agricultural products to Japan with a 24 percent share of total imports, followed by the European Union, China, Australia, and Thailand.
